Title:
SPACER FOR FUEL ASSEMBLY

Abstract:

PURPOSE: To improve cooling efficiency of a fuel rod and heighten the boiling transition output of nuclear fuel by providing a liquid membrane separating plate in the upstream side of a spacer at which boiling transition is produced and pressing it in the inside of a channel box.

CONSTITUTION: A spacer 1 maintains a fuel rod position of a fuel assembly and mutual intervals of fuel rods for a boiling water reactor in which the fuel rods 2 are arranged in approximately square lattice shape. Liquid membrane separating plates 27 are provided in the upstream side of the spacer 1 and pressed and brought into contact on the inner circumferential face 23 of a channel box arranged in the outside of the spacer 1. Since the liquid membrane flowing in the inner circumferential face 23 of the channel box is taken off and dispersed by the liquid membrane separating plate 27, the fuel rods 6 can effectively be cooled. Especially, since the position of the boiling transition produced is that of a few millimeters in the upstream side of the spacer 1 and the liquid droplets obtained by the liquid membrane separating plates 27 reach the fuel rods, the cooling effect of the fuel rods is increased and the boiling transition output of the fuel is enlarged.
